Co-Piloti AI vs Agenti AI: Panoramica Veloce
I Co-Piloti AI e gli Agenti AI svolgono ruoli distinti nel migliorare la produttività e l’automazione. Di seguito, troverai una tabella comparativa rapida che evidenzia le principali differenze tra Co-Piloti AI e Agenti AI.
Caratteristica | Co-Piloti AI | Agenti AI |
---|---|---|
Autonomia | Limitata, opera con la guida dell’utente | Completamente autonomo, prende decisioni indipendenti |
Stile di interazione | Lavora al fianco degli utenti, fornendo suggerimenti | Agisce in modo indipendente, interagisce con il suo ambiente |
Controllo | L’utente rimane in controllo, approva le azioni | Opera senza controllo diretto dell’utente |
Principali casi d’uso | Miglioramento dei compiti, fornendo approfondimenti, migliorando l’efficienza | Automazione dei compiti, presa di decisioni indipendenti |
Esempi | GitHub Copilot, Microsoft 365 Copilot | ChatGPT per il servizio clienti, AgentGPT |
Processo decisionale | Minimo; richiede approvazione dell’utente | Alto: capace di prendere decisioni autonomamente |
Adattabilità | Limitato agli input immediati dell’utente | Si adatta tramite l’apprendimento e l’esperienza passata |
Applicazioni ideali | Creazione di documenti, assistenza alla programmazione, analisi dei dati | Supporto autonomo clienti, gestione dei flussi di lavoro |
Cosa sono i Co-Piloti AI?
I Co-Piloti AI sono progettati come strumenti collaborativi che migliorano la produttività dell’utente. Sono come aiutanti intelligenti, che offrono assistenza e approfondimenti senza prendere il controllo.
I Co-Piloti lavorano spesso all’interno di ambienti software, facendo suggerimenti, completando compiti ripetitivi e supportando gli utenti in tempo reale.
Caratteristiche principali dei Co-Piloti AI
- Collaborazione in tempo reale: I Co-Piloti assistono gli utenti in tempo reale, offrendo suggerimenti, automatizzando compiti ripetitivi e consentendo agli utenti di mantenere il controllo.
- Consapevolezza contestuale: Analizzano l’attività dell’utente e forniscono approfondimenti o raccomandazioni pertinenti basate sul contesto attuale.
- Autonomia limitata: I Co-Piloti operano sotto la supervisione dell’utente e richiedono l’approvazione per ogni azione, rendendoli ideali per ruoli di supporto piuttosto che per l’esecuzione indipendente.
- Esperienza specifica del dominio: Spesso personalizzati per applicazioni specifiche, come la programmazione, la scrittura o l’analisi dei dati, i Co-Piloti si specializzano nel migliorare i compiti in un particolare campo.
- Integrazione con gli strumenti dell’utente: Generalmente integrati all’interno di software esistenti, i Co-Piloti ottimizzano i flussi di lavoro integrandosi perfettamente in piattaforme come IDE o editor di testo.
Pro e Contro dei Co-Piloti AI
Pros
- Controllo Utente Migliorato: Gli utenti mantengono il controllo di ogni compito, riducendo i rischi di errore.
- Efficienza Specifica per Compito: Specializzato in compiti ripetitivi e strutturati, risparmiando tempo.
- Integrazione Senza Soluzione di Continuità: Funziona all’interno degli strumenti dell’utente per un’esperienza fluida.
Cons
- Autonomia Limitata: Non può operare in modo indipendente, richiedendo l’input dell’utente.
- Dipendente dal Contesto: I suggerimenti sono limitati alle azioni e agli input dell’utente.
- Mancanza di Capacità Decisionali: Non può avviare o completare compiti autonomamente.
Che Cosa Sono gli Agenti AI?
Gli Agenti AI sono entità indipendenti che operano autonomamente, prendendo decisioni e svolgendo compiti senza la guida umana.
A differenza dei Co-Piloti, che agiscono come assistenti, gli Agenti AI funzionano come sistemi autosufficienti, progettati per prendere il controllo ed eseguire compiti complessi in modo autonomo.
Caratteristiche principali degli Agenti AI
- Autonomia: Gli Agenti AI possono funzionare in modo indipendente, prendendo decisioni e compiendo azioni in base agli obiettivi programmati.
- Comportamento orientato agli obiettivi: Sono progettati per raggiungere obiettivi specifici, utilizzando algoritmi e dati per determinare le azioni migliori da intraprendere.
- Interazione con l’ambiente: Gli Agenti AI interagiscono continuamente con il loro ambiente, adattandosi a nuovi input e condizioni che cambiano.
- Apprendimento e adattabilità: Molti Agenti AI utilizzano l’apprendimento automatico per migliorare le loro prestazioni nel tempo, adattando il loro comportamento in base alle esperienze passate.
- Capacità decisionale: Hanno la capacità di analizzare i dati, fare scelte e agire senza l’intervento umano, permettendo risposte in tempo reale in ambienti dinamici.
Vantaggi e Svantaggi degli Agenti AI
Pros
- Alta autonomia: Funziona in modo indipendente, riducendo la necessità di supervisione.
- Efficienza per compiti ripetitivi: Gestisce grandi volumi senza affaticamento.
- Adattabilità in tempo reale: Si adatta rapidamente ai cambiamenti nell’ambiente.
Cons
- Rischio di azioni indesiderate: La mancanza di supervisione può portare a decisioni inaspettate.
- Preoccupazioni sulla privacy: Il funzionamento autonomo può sollevare problemi di privacy e sicurezza.
- Impostazione e manutenzione complesse: Richiede una programmazione e monitoraggio accurati.
Co-piloti AI vs Agenti AI: Confronto approfondito
Autonomia
Co-piloti AI: I Co-piloti AI sono progettati per funzionare con un’autonomia limitata, operando sotto la guida dell’utente. Richiedono input e direzione da parte degli utenti e tipicamente agiscono come strati intelligenti sui flussi di lavoro esistenti, migliorando la produttività senza prendere decisioni in modo indipendente.
Agenti AI: Gli Agenti AI sono completamente autonomi e possono svolgere compiti e prendere decisioni senza alcun intervento umano. Analizzano il loro ambiente e determinano il corso d’azione migliore per raggiungere i loro obiettivi, il che consente loro di operare in modo indipendente.
Stile di interazione
Co-piloti AI: I Co-piloti AI lavorano insieme agli utenti offrendo suggerimenti e approfondimenti quando necessario. Agiscono come partner collaborativi nei compiti, guidando le decisioni dell’utente e supportando la produttività senza prendere il controllo.
Ad esempio, un Co-Pilota AI in un’applicazione di modifica documenti potrebbe suggerire modifiche o miglioramenti, ma lascia l’approvazione finale all’utente. Questo tipo di interazione consente un’esperienza più guidata e di supporto, rendendo i Co-Piloti ideali per ambienti in cui sono necessarie supervisione e controllo da parte dell’utente.
Agenti AI: Gli Agenti AI agiscono in modo indipendente e interagiscono direttamente con il loro ambiente. Continuano a percepire, analizzare e rispondere alle condizioni in tempo reale, il che consente loro di adattarsi dinamicamente a nuovi dati e condizioni mutevoli.
Un Agente AI in un ruolo di assistenza clienti, ad esempio, può gestire e risolvere le richieste autonomamente, rispondendo alle necessità dei clienti senza il costante intervento di un supervisore umano.
Controllo
Co-Piloti AI: In termini di controllo, i Co-Piloti AI sono progettati per mantenere l’utente in controllo, con gli utenti che approvano le azioni prima che vengano completate. I Co-Piloti forniscono suggerimenti e linee guida, ma si affidano all’utente per prendere la decisione finale su ogni azione.
Questo approccio è molto utile in applicazioni come il suggerimento di codice o la creazione di documenti, dove è necessaria una supervisione per garantire la qualità e la pertinenza.
Agenti AI: Gli Agenti AI, d’altra parte, operano senza un controllo diretto dell’utente. Sono progettati per gestire i compiti in modo indipendente, eseguendo azioni quando necessario senza aspettare l’approvazione dell’utente.
Questo consente loro di snellire i flussi di lavoro in ambienti che richiedono risposte rapide o dove una supervisione costante rallenterebbe i processi.
Ad esempio, in uno scenario di gestione logistica, un Agente AI potrebbe gestire autonomamente la pianificazione e l’invio delle attività, ottimizzando l’efficienza senza l’intervento umano.
Prendere Decisioni
Co-Piloti AI: I Co-Piloti AI operano con un potere decisionale minimo, richiedendo l’approvazione dell’utente per ogni azione suggerita. Supportano l’utente con raccomandazioni e intuizioni, ma lasciano le decisioni finali all’utente, assicurandosi che le attività siano allineate strettamente con l’intento dell’utente.
Ad esempio, in un ambiente di codifica, un Co-Pilota potrebbe suggerire uno snippet di codice in base all’input dell’utente, ma spetta allo sviluppatore rivedere e implementare il suggerimento.
Agenti AI: Gli Agenti AI, invece, sono progettati per prendere decisioni in modo autonomo. Possono valutare le situazioni, pesare le opzioni e intraprendere azioni indipendenti per raggiungere i loro obiettivi. Questo li rende ideali per compiti che richiedono decisioni frequenti o immediate senza l’intervento umano.
Ad esempio, un Agente AI in un ruolo di supporto clienti può risolvere autonomamente le richieste analizzando i dati dell’utente, scegliendo la risposta migliore, e fornendo la soluzione senza aspettare un input umano.
Adattabilità
AI Copilot: I Co-Pilot AI sono limitati nell’adattabilità, adattandosi solo in base agli input immediati dell’utente e al contesto. Funzionano bene in ambienti prevedibili e controllati, ma mancano delle capacità di apprendimento a lungo termine necessarie per adattarsi in modo indipendente nel tempo. Questo ne limita l’uso ad ambienti in cui i compiti sono strutturati e prevedibili.
AI Agent: Gli Agent AI, al contrario, sono spesso dotati di capacità di apprendimento che consentono loro di migliorare le prestazioni nel tempo. Grazie a tecniche come il reinforcement learning (apprendimento per rinforzo), molti AI Agent possono perfezionare le loro risposte sulla base delle interazioni passate e dei cambiamenti ambientali.
Questa adattabilità è particolarmente utile in contesti dinamici, come la gestione delle smart home o l’assistenza clienti automatizzata, dove gli agenti devono apprendere e adattarsi continuamente per ottimizzare le prestazioni.
Architettura Tecnica
AI Copilot: I Co-Pilot si basano su modelli pre-addestrati (spesso large language models) ottimizzati per domini specifici, come la programmazione o la creazione di documenti. Operano tipicamente all’interno di un ambiente software specifico, utilizzando le informazioni contestuali delle azioni dell’utente per offrire suggerimenti pertinenti.
Esempio: GitHub Copilot utilizza i modelli linguistici di OpenAI, analizzando il contesto del codice dell’utente per fornire suggerimenti pertinenti.
AI Agent: Gli Agent AI utilizzano tipicamente il reinforcement learning e un ciclo “percepire-pensare-agire”. Raccolgono dati dall’ambiente, li elaborano tramite algoritmi di intelligenza artificiale e agiscono in base a obiettivi predefiniti.
Gli agenti possono apprendere dalle interazioni passate e adattare nel tempo le proprie risposte. Questa architettura consente loro di operare in modo indipendente in ambienti dinamici, rendendoli adatti a compiti complessi e in evoluzione.
Esempio: AgentGPT può gestire autonomamente prenotazioni di viaggio rilevando le opzioni disponibili, analizzando le scelte migliori e agendo senza input aggiuntivi.
Applicazioni dei Co-Piloti AI e degli Agenti AI
Co-Piloti AI: Dove il Controllo Umano è Fondamentale
I co-piloti eccellono in applicazioni dove il controllo e la guida dell’utente sono essenziali. Migliorano la produttività in compiti strutturati e prevedibili senza prendere il controllo completo. Gli esempi includono:
- Creazione di Documenti: Aiuta nella redazione e modifica dei documenti, fornendo controlli grammaticali e suggerimenti per i contenuti (es. Microsoft 365 Copilot).
- Sviluppo Software: Supporta gli sviluppatori offrendo suggerimenti di codice e riducendo errori di digitazione e di codifica ripetitivi (es. GitHub Copilot).
- Analisi dei Dati: Fornisce intuizioni sui dati e aiuta gli utenti a visualizzare le tendenze, ideale per fogli di calcolo o strumenti BI.
Agenti AI: Dove l’Autonomia è Essenziale
Gli Agenti AI sono adatti per applicazioni che richiedono una supervisione minima e sono in grado di gestire autonomamente compiti e prendere decisioni in tempo reale. Gli esempi includono:
- Servizio Clienti: Gestisce autonomamente le richieste e risolve i problemi, migliorando i tempi di risposta senza l’intervento umano.
- Automazione Aziendale: Automatizza i processi aziendali ripetitivi, come la gestione delle e-mail o l’elaborazione delle fatture.
- Gestione Domotica: Controlla dispositivi e sistemi in una casa, come la regolazione dei termostati o la gestione della sicurezza, in base ai parametri programmati.
- Sicurezza informatica: Identifica e blocca minacce di phishing analizzando autonomamente i dati in tempo reale. Le organizzazioni utilizzano strumenti di rilevamento del phishing basati sull’IA per anticipare gli attacchi in evoluzione.
Il Futuro dei Co-Piloti AI e degli Agenti AI
Man mano che l’AI continua a svilupparsi, sia i Co-Piloti che gli Agenti avranno ruoli cruciali nel posto di lavoro. Si prevede che i Co-Piloti AI diventino più intuitivi, supportando compiti sempre più complessi mantenendo comunque il controllo da parte degli utenti.
Potrebbero anche espandersi in nuovi settori, fornendo supporto specializzato in vari settori. D’altra parte, gli Agenti AI sono destinati a evolversi verso una maggiore autonomia e adattabilità.
Con i progressi nell’apprendimento automatico, gli agenti probabilmente diventeranno più sofisticati, capaci di prendere decisioni sfumate in ambienti complessi.
Potrebbero anche diventare più specializzati, gestendo flussi di lavoro specifici in settori come la sanità, la finanza e la logistica. Un futuro in cui Co-Piloti e Agenti coesistono offre il meglio di entrambi i mondi: una fusione senza soluzione di continuità di assistenza di supporto e competenza autonoma, migliorando la produttività e l’efficienza in tutti i settori.
Domande Frequenti: Co-Piloti AI vs Agenti AI
Quali sono le applicazioni comuni dei Co-Piloti AI?
I Co-Piloti AI possono prendere decisioni in modo autonomo?
I Co-Piloti AI e gli Agenti AI sono adatti per settori diversi?
Qual è migliore: un Co-Pilota AI o un Agente AI?
I Co-Piloti AI e gli Agenti AI possono essere usati insieme nella stessa organizzazione?
Conclusione
I Co-Piloti AI e gli Agenti AI offrono vantaggi distinti. I Co-Piloti sono ideali per scenari in cui è essenziale il controllo umano, fornendo supporto prezioso e migliorando la produttività dell’utente.
Al contrario, gli Agenti AI eccellono in ambienti autonomi, gestendo compiti in modo indipendente e adattandosi a situazioni dinamiche.
Man mano che il posto di lavoro continua ad abbracciare l’AI, comprendere i punti di forza unici dei Co-Piloti AI vs Agenti AI sarà essenziale per sfruttare il pieno potenziale di queste tecnologie.
Che si tratti di un Co-Pilota che offre intuizioni al tuo fianco o di un Agente che gestisce autonomamente i compiti, entrambi gli approcci stanno aprendo la strada a un futuro più efficiente, guidato dall’AI.